SP can be very scary. I dealt with it for a long time before learning to 'let go' 'take control' whatever. I imagine your first few SP's will be at least a little scary no matter what. The most important thing, and I know it's cliche around here, is to believe its not real. As your starting out you should be prepared for auditory hallucinations and strange clouds/forms (sometimes looking like an 'Old Hag'). I no longer experience any of these, and I miss the auditory stuff! For me it goes like this. I open my eyes and basically see the room. Of course it's not really the room just my projection of it. Notice the subtle differences! For me it's usually blurry edges and such. This is when I become lucid. Now I have to move. Sometimes it's easy and sometimes it's not. If it is hard try not to be afraid as this will effect the nature of your dream world. I have found that rocking up, like an old man getting out of a comfy couch, helps me. Once up I can manipulate my environment, float (usually across water) and walk through doors and walls...etc. GOOD LUCK
